Home
last modified time | relevance | path

Searched refs:CodeViewContainer (Results 1 – 20 of 20) sorted by relevance

/freebsd/contrib/llvm-project/llvm/include/llvm/DebugInfo/CodeView/
H A DSymbolRecordMapping.h24 CodeViewContainer Container) in SymbolRecordMapping()
27 CodeViewContainer Container) in SymbolRecordMapping()
42 CodeViewContainer Container;
H A DSymbolDeserializer.h26 MappingInfo(ArrayRef<uint8_t> RecordData, CodeViewContainer Container) in MappingInfo()
39 SymbolDeserializer S(nullptr, CodeViewContainer::ObjectFile); in deserializeAs()
56 CodeViewContainer Container) in SymbolDeserializer()
93 CodeViewContainer Container;
H A DSymbolDumper.h31 CodeViewContainer Container, in CVSymbolDumper()
53 CodeViewContainer Container;
H A DSymbolSerializer.h50 SymbolSerializer(BumpPtrAllocator &Storage, CodeViewContainer Container);
54 CodeViewContainer Container) { in writeOneSymbol()
H A DCodeView.h593 enum class CodeViewContainer { ObjectFile, Pdb }; enum
595 inline uint32_t alignOf(CodeViewContainer Container) { in alignOf()
596 if (Container == CodeViewContainer::ObjectFile) in alignOf()
H A DDebugSubsectionRecord.h66 CodeViewContainer Container) const;
/freebsd/contrib/llvm-project/llvm/lib/DebugInfo/PDB/Native/
H A DDbiModuleDescriptorBuilder.cpp84 assert(BulkSymbols.size() % alignOf(CodeViewContainer::Pdb) == 0 && in addSymbolsInBulk()
96 assert(SymLength % alignOf(CodeViewContainer::Pdb) == 0 && in addUnmergedSymbols()
196 assert(SymbolWriter.getOffset() % alignOf(CodeViewContainer::Pdb) == 0 && in commitSymbolStream()
200 if (auto EC = Builder.commit(SymbolWriter, CodeViewContainer::Pdb)) in commitSymbolStream()
H A DGSIStreamBuilder.cpp376 CodeViewContainer::Pdb)); in serializeAndAddGlobal()
/freebsd/contrib/llvm-project/llvm/include/llvm/ObjectYAML/
H A DCodeViewYAMLSymbols.h38 codeview::CodeViewContainer Container) const;
/freebsd/contrib/llvm-project/lld/COFF/
H A DPDB.cpp601 alignTo(sym.length(), alignOf(CodeViewContainer::Pdb)); in analyzeSymbolSubsection()
679 alignTo(sym.length(), alignOf(CodeViewContainer::Pdb)); in writeAllModuleSymbolRecords()
1466 ons, bAlloc, CodeViewContainer::Pdb)); in addCommonLinkerModuleSymbols()
1468 cs, bAlloc, CodeViewContainer::Pdb)); in addCommonLinkerModuleSymbols()
1470 ebs, bAlloc, CodeViewContainer::Pdb)); in addCommonLinkerModuleSymbols()
1496 cgs, bAlloc(), CodeViewContainer::Pdb)); in addLinkerModuleCoffGroup()
1509 sym, bAlloc(), CodeViewContainer::Pdb)); in addLinkerModuleSectionSymbol()
1588 ons, bAlloc, CodeViewContainer::Pdb)); in addImportFilesToPDB()
1590 cs, bAlloc, CodeViewContainer::Pdb)); in addImportFilesToPDB()
1593 ts, bAlloc, CodeViewContainer::Pdb); in addImportFilesToPDB()
[all …]
/freebsd/contrib/llvm-project/llvm/lib/DebugInfo/CodeView/
H A DSymbolSerializer.cpp20 CodeViewContainer Container) in SymbolSerializer()
H A DDebugSubsectionRecord.cpp68 CodeViewContainer Container) const { in commit()
H A DRecordName.cpp329 SymbolRecordMapping Mapping(Reader, CodeViewContainer::ObjectFile); in getSymbolName()
/freebsd/contrib/llvm-project/llvm/lib/ObjectYAML/
H A DCodeViewYAMLSymbols.cpp251 CodeViewContainer Container) const = 0;
263 CodeViewContainer Container) const override { in toCodeViewSymbol()
280 CodeViewContainer Container) const override { in toCodeViewSymbol()
618 BumpPtrAllocator &Allocator, CodeViewContainer Container) const { in toCodeViewSymbol()
H A DCOFFEmitter.cpp183 Err(B.commit(Writer, CodeViewContainer::ObjectFile)); in toDebugS()
H A DCodeViewYAMLDebugSections.cpp492 Sym.toCodeViewSymbol(Allocator, CodeViewContainer::ObjectFile)); in toCodeViewSubsection()
/freebsd/contrib/llvm-project/llvm/lib/DebugInfo/LogicalView/Readers/
H A DLVCodeViewReader.cpp625 CodeViewContainer::ObjectFile); in traverseSymbolsSubsection()
980 SymbolDeserializer Deserializer(nullptr, CodeViewContainer::Pdb); in createScopes()
1036 SymbolDeserializer Deserializer(nullptr, CodeViewContainer::Pdb); in createScopes()
/freebsd/contrib/llvm-project/llvm/tools/llvm-pdbutil/
H A DDumpOutputStyle.cpp1434 SymbolDeserializer Deserializer(nullptr, CodeViewContainer::ObjectFile); in dumpModuleSymsForObj()
1481 SymbolDeserializer Deserializer(nullptr, CodeViewContainer::Pdb); in dumpModuleSymsForPdb()
1560 SymbolDeserializer Deserializer(nullptr, CodeViewContainer::Pdb); in dumpGSIRecords()
1599 SymbolDeserializer Deserializer(nullptr, CodeViewContainer::Pdb); in dumpGlobals()
1705 SymbolDeserializer Deserializer(nullptr, CodeViewContainer::Pdb); in dumpSymbolsFromGSI()
H A Dllvm-pdbutil.cpp851 Symbol.toCodeViewSymbol(Allocator, CodeViewContainer::Pdb)); in yamlToPdb()
/freebsd/contrib/llvm-project/llvm/tools/llvm-readobj/
H A DCOFFDumper.cpp1404 CVSymbolDumper CVSD(W, Types, CodeViewContainer::ObjectFile, std::move(CODD), in printCodeViewSymbolsSubsection()